Alright, so the other day I was battling it out in Pokémon, and I kept getting zapped by these Electric-type Pokémon. It was super annoying! I knew I needed a solid counter, so I started digging around to figure out what beats an Electric-type Pokémon.

My Research Process Begins
First, I jumped onto some forums and fan sites. I figured, who better to ask than a bunch of dedicated players? I read through a bunch of threads, and a pattern started to emerge.
- Everyone kept saying the same thing: Ground, Ground, Ground!
It turns out that Ground-type moves are “super effective” against Electric-types. Like, they do double damage! I kinda knew this already, but I hadn’t really put it into practice before.
